Glass-Filled Polyamide PA66 KS, Premium Grade (OST 6-11-498-79)
Description
A strong, heat-resistant, premium-grade injection molding polymer: glass-filled polyamide 66 reinforced with 30 % glass fiber, manufactured according to OST 6-11-498-79, a standard proven over decades.
Key characteristics of glass-filled polyamide PA66 KS premium grade include:
- high stiffness, strength and impact toughness
- resistance to thermal warpage
- reduced coefficient of friction and wear
- resistant to kerosene, gasoline, benzene, mineral oils, alkalis and acids
- long-term serviceability under simultaneous exposure to elevated temperatures
Applications
PA66-KS is intended for structural and electrical-insulation products used in machine building, electronics, the automotive industry and instrument making, operating at elevated temperatures.

Physical properties:
Glass fiber content
%
30 (ISO 3451-1)
Water absorption (24 h, 23 °C)
%
0.8…1.5 (ISO 62)
Density
g/cm³
1.35 (ISO 1183-1)
Electrical properties:
Dielectric strength
kV/mm
19 (IEC 60243-1)
Volume resistivity
Ω·cm
2×10¹⁴ (IEC 62631-3-1)
Dielectric dissipation factor (1 MHz)
—
0.03 (IEC 62631-2-1)
Surface resistivity
Ω
2×10¹⁴ (IEC 62631-3-2)
Mechanical properties:
Tensile strength
MPa
132 (ISO 527-1/-2)
Flexural strength
MPa
196 (ISO 178)
Mold shrinkage
%
0.6…1.0 (ISO 294-4)
Charpy impact strength (unnotched, 23 °C)
kJ/m²
24.5 (ISO 179-1/1eU)
Dielectric permittivity (1 MHz)
—
3.0 (IEC 62631-2-1)
Vicat softening temperature (B/50N)
°C
250 (ISO 306)
Thermal properties:
Melting temperature (Tm)
°C
250 (ISO 11357-3)
Martens temperature (obsolete, replaced by HDT/A)
°C
230 (ASTM D648)
